Номер патента: 1397899

Авторы: Гриневич, Демидов, Ментюк, Семашко

ZIP архив

Текст

СООЗ СОВЕТСКИХСОЦИАЛИСТИЧЕСКИХРЕСПУБЛИК 9 19) 0677 ОПИСАНИЕ ИЗОБРЕТЕНК АВТОРСКОМУ СВИДЕТЕЛЪСТВУ Бюл, 11 19ашко, В. Г. Гр М.А.Ментюк 888) о СССР1984.СССР1977. свидетельст С 06 Р 7/00 видетельство С 06 Р 7/00,(54) ЯЧЕЙКА (57) Изобрет тельной техн матрицу вычи родной среды тельной сист ОРОДНОЙ СРЕДЫ ие относится к вычислие и позволяет строить ительных яче к одновычислиетения -озможн ос универсально мы. Цель изо ункциональных асшире СУДАРСТВЕННЫЙ КОМИТЕТ СССР0 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ТКРЫТИЙ(21) 4145259/ (22) 10.11.86 (46) 23.05.88 (72) А. Н.Сем А.В.Демидов и (53) 681,3 (О (56) Авторско Ф 1218378, клАвторское В 69846, кл теи за счет реализации операций над четырьмя входными переменными и функций самодиагиостирования. Ячейка содержит информационные входы 1-4, мультиплексоры 5-9, настроечные вхо" ды 10-11, регистры 12, 13, настроечные выходы 14, арифметико-логические элементы 15, 16, 17, дешифраторы 18-20, элементы задержки 2 1-24, демультиплексоры 25-29, информационные выходы 30-33. Применение ячейки поз воляет выполнять операции над четырьмя переменными функции условных пе-, реходов и функции самодиагностирования, за счет чего повышается коэффициент использования и процент выхода годных ячеек при их производстве.ил.Изобретение относится к вычислительной технике и предназначено дляформирования однородных сред.Цель изобретения - расширение5функциональных возможностей за счетреализации операций над четырьмя переменными и функций самодиагностирования,На чертеже представлена функциональная схема ячейки,Ячейка имеет информационные входы1-4, мультиплексоры 5-9, настроечныевходы 10-11 , регистры 12 и 13 команд, настроечные выходы 14,-14,арифметико-логические элементы (АЛЭ)15-17, дешифраторы 18-20, элементы21-24 задержки, демультиплексоры 2529, информационные выходы 30-33, выходы 34-44 регистров команд. 20Ячейка работает следующим образом.Перед началом решения задачи производится запись двух команд в регистры 12 и 13 команд последовательным кодом через настроечные входы 2510, и 10 по сигналу разрешения ввода программ, подаваемому на настроечные входы 11, и 11 , По окончаниисигнала, разрешающего ввод программы,коды двух команд запоминаются в регистрах 12 и 13 и ячейка переходит вдинамический режим выполнения операций.Ячейка принимает данные с четырехинформационных входов 1-4 через муль 35типлексоры 5, 6 и 8, 9 в зависимостиот управляющих сигналов, поступающихна эти мультиплексоры. Адреса приемаданных определяются сигналами выходоврегистров 38 и 39 команд. Данные для 40первого АЛЭ 15 поступают через мультиплексоры 5 и 6, для второго АЛЭ -через мультиплексоры 8-9. ПервыйАЛЭ 15 настраивается на выполнениеарифметических и логических операцийсигналов с дешифратора 18 в зависи 45мости от содержимого 34 регистра команд 12, Второй АЛЭ 16, аналогичнопервому, но независимо от него, настраивается на выполнение операцийсигналом с дешифратора 19, которыйопределяется содержимым 35 второгорегистра команд, В зависимости отсигналов с выходов 36 и 37 регистровкомандрезультаты операцийдвух АЛЭ 15и 16 могутвыдаваться с задержкой илибез нее через демультиплексоры 25 и28 на информационные выходы 30-33ячейки. Номер информационного выхода определяется содержимым 40 и 41 регистров 12 и 13 команд и сигналамис выхода 40 и 41 этих регистров. Кроме этого, результаты операций первогои второго АЛЭ 15 и 16 выдаются натретий АЛЭ 17, который настраиваетсяна выполнение операций в зависимостиот содержимого 421 и 421 регистров12 и 13 команд, поступающего на дешифратор 20, и сигналом с этого дешифратора. Результат операции третьего АЛЭ 17 выдается через демультиплексор 29 на один из четырех информационных выходов в зависимости отсодержимого 441 и 44 регистров команд,Независимо от выполняемых операций в трех АЛЭ 15-17 ячейкой осуществляется транзит входных данных черезмультиплексор 7 по одному из четырехвходов, определяемому содержимым43, и 43 регистров команд. Транзитные данные выдаются через демультиплексоры 26 и 27 с задержкой на одинтакт ипи на два такта соответственночерез элементы 22 или же 22 и 23 задержки. Номер информационного выхода,по которому выдаются транзитные данные, определяется содержимым 44, и44 регистров команд.Таким образом, в этом режиме.ячейка может выполнять; операции над двумя парами переменных, с задержкойвыдачи информации или без задержкиее по двум независимым информационным выходам, операции над четырьмяэтими переменными и выдачу результатов по третьему информационному выходу, независимо передавать информациюс одного из информационных входов,с задержкой на один разряд или надва разряда на один из информационных выходов. Кроме этого, ячейка может выполнять операции условногоперехода и самоконтроля,Для выполнения операции условногоперехода необходимо настроить третийАЛЭ 17 на операцию сравнения двухрезультатов операций первого и второго АЛЭ 15 и 16 в соответствии ссодержимым 42, и 42 регистров команд. Первые два АЛЭ 15 и 16 могутвыполнять любые операции над входными переменными, поступающими по любым информационным входам. Если результаты операций первого и второгоАЛЭ 15 и 16 сравнялись, то дальнейшее выполнение программы будет опре 3 139 деляться первым регистром команд и на выход ячейки будут выдаваться результаты первого АЛЭ 15 через демультиплексор 25. В противном случае будут выдаваться результаты второго АЛЭ 16 через демультиплексор 28,При выполнении операции самодиагностирования ячейкой необходимо, чтобы данные поступали с двух информационных входов через входные мультиплексоры 5-6 и 8-9 соответственно на входы первого и второго АЛЭ 15 и 16, которые сигналами с дешифраторов 18 и 19 должны быть настроены на одну и ту же операцию. Третий АЛЭ 17 сигналом с дешифратора 20 настраивается на операцию сравнения результатов первых двух АЛЭ 15 и 16. В случае исправности обоих АЛЭ 15 и 16 их результаты будут равны и с выхода третьего АЛЭ 17 через демультиплексор 29 можно выдавать сигнал исправности ячейки по одному информационному выходу. В противном случае с выхода третьего АЛЭ 17 через демультиплексор 29 можно выдать сигнал неисправности ячейки.Формула изобретенияЯчейка однородной среды, содержащая первый регистр команд, первый дешифратор, первый арифметико-логический элемент, первый, второй и третий элементы задержки, три мультиплексора и четыре демультиплексора причем информационные входы первого, второго и третьего мультиплексоров соединены с информационными входами ячейки, настроечные вкоды первой группы которой соединены с настроечными входами первого регистра команд, настроечный выход которого соединен с первым настроечным выходом ячейки, информационные выходы которой соединены с выходами первого, второго, третьего и четвертого демультиплексоров, первый выход первого регистра команд соединен с входом первого дешифратора, выход которого соединен с настроечным входом первого арифметико"логического элемента, информационные входы которого соединены с выходами первого и второго мультиплексоров, управляющие входы которых соединены с вторым выходом первого регистра команд, третий выход которого соединен с управляющим входом первого7899 510 тий дешифраторы, четвертый элемент задержки, второй регистр команд и пятый демультиплексор, причем информационные входы ячейки соединены с информационными входами четвертого 35и пятого мультиплексоров, выходы которых соединены с информационными входами второго арифметико-логического элемента, настроечные входы которого соединены с выходом второго дешифратора, вход которого соединен с первым выходом второго регистра команд, второй выход которого соединен с управляющим входом четвертого элемента задержки, информационный вход которого соединен с выходом второго арифметико-логического элемента и первым информационным входом третьего арифметико-логического элемента, выход которого соединен с информационным входом четвертого демультиплексора, а второй информационный и настроечный входы третьего арифметико,логического элемента соединены соответственно с выходом первого арифметико-логического элемента и выходом третьего дешифратора, входы которого соединены с седьмым выходом первого регистра команд и третьим выходом 15 20 25 30 элемента задержки, информационныйвход которого соединен с выходом первого арифметико-логического элемента,выход первого элемента задержки соединен с информационным входом первого демультиплексора, управляющий входкоторого соединен с четвертым выходомпервого регистра команд, пятый выходкоторого соединен с управляющими входами в торо го, тре тье го и че тве рто годемультиплексоров, информационныйвход второго демультиплексора соединен с выходом второго элемента задержки, вход которого соединен с выходомтретьего мультиплексора, управляющийвход которого соединен с шестым выходом первого регистра команд, выходвторого элемента задержки соединенс входом третьего элемента задержки,выход которого соединен с информационным входом третьего демультиплексора, о т л и ч а ю щ а я с я тем, что,с целью расширения функциональныхвозможностей за счет реализации операций над четырьмя входными переменными и функции самодиагностирования,в нее введены четвертый и пятый мультиплексоры, второй и третий арифметико-логические элементы, второй и треСоставитель О, Вере эиковаТехред Л.Олийнык Корректор М,Максимишинец Редактор Е.Папп Тираж 704 Подписное ВНИИПИ Государственного комитета СССР по делам изобретений и открытий 113035, Москва, Ж, Раушская наб д, 4/5Заказ 227 1/47 Производственно-полиграфическое предприятие, г. Ужгород, ул. Проектная, 4 5 1397899 6второго регистра команд, четвертый ционный вход которого соединен с выход которого соединен с управляю- выходом четвертого элемента задержщими входами четвертого и пятого , ки, выходы пятого демультиплексора мультиплексоров, пятый, шестой и соединены с информационными выходами5седьмой выходы второго регистра ко- ячейки, настроечные входы второй канд соединены соответственно с группы которой соединены с настроечуправляющимивходами второго демуль- ными входами второго регистра команд, типпексора, третьего мультиплексора настроечный выход которого соединен и пятого демультиплексора, информа с вторым настроечным выходом ячейки.

Смотреть

Заявка

4145259, 10.11.1986

МИНСКОЕ ВЫСШЕЕ ИНЖЕНЕРНОЕ ЗЕНИТНОЕ РАКЕТНОЕ УЧИЛИЩЕ ПРОТИВОВОЗДУШНОЙ ОБОРОНЫ

СЕМАШКО АЛЕКСАНДР НИКОЛАЕВИЧ, ГРИНЕВИЧ ВЛАДИМИР ГЕОРГИЕВИЧ, ДЕМИДОВ АНАТОЛИЙ ВАСИЛЬЕВИЧ, МЕНТЮК МЕЧИСЛАВ АЛЬБИНОВИЧ

МПК / Метки

МПК: G06F 7/00

Метки: однородной, среды, ячейка

Опубликовано: 23.05.1988

Код ссылки

<a href="https://patents.su/4-1397899-yachejjka-odnorodnojj-sredy.html" target="_blank" rel="follow" title="База патентов СССР">Ячейка однородной среды</a>

Похожие патенты